Transportation, Storage and Handling of Pipes and Fittings
Pipes and fittings must be transported using suitable vehicles and appropriate handling equipment. Throughout transportation, loading, unloading, and on-site handling, all products should be carefully protected to prevent impact, deformation, scratching, or other forms of damage.
Before unloading, the receiving personnel should carefully inspect the pipes, fittings, and other products on the vehicle. Any visible damage, deformation, or missing components should be reported to the truck driver immediately and clearly recorded on the relevant delivery or shipping documents. Damaged products should be identified and separated to prevent them from being accidentally installed.
The contractor or site management team should designate a suitable storage area before the products arrive at the construction site. The storage area should be level, stable, clean, and free from large stones, sharp objects, construction debris, or other materials that could damage the pipes. It should also be located away from heavy construction traffic and other activities that may cause accidental impact.
Pipes should be placed on a stable surface and properly supported during storage. Care should be taken to prevent pipes from rolling, sliding, or being exposed to unnecessary mechanical impact. Where possible, pipes should be protected from contamination and excessive exposure to conditions that could affect their condition before installation.
Unloading of Pipes
- When cranes, hoists, or other lifting equipment are used to unload pipes, only suitable lifting belts or soft slings should be used. Steel wire ropes, chains, hooks, or other sharp-edged lifting devices should not come into direct contact with the pipe surface, as they may cause scratches, cuts, or other damage.
- Before lifting, all lifting belts and slings should be inspected to ensure that they are in good condition and have sufficient load-bearing capacity for the pipes being handled.
- When using a forklift to unload pipes, the forks should be carefully inspected for sharp edges, burrs, or other projections that could damage the pipe. Protective material, such as suitable protective film or rubber covering, should be placed around the fork tips where necessary.
- When handling large-diameter pipes, the operator should ensure that the pipe is properly balanced and securely supported before lifting. Sudden lifting, dropping, dragging, or rolling of pipes should be avoided.
- Pipes should never be thrown from the vehicle or allowed to fall freely during unloading. All lifting and handling operations should be carried out slowly and under proper supervision.
Unloading of Fittings
The same general handling and safety requirements applicable to pipes should also be followed when unloading fittings.
- When lifting fittings, the lifting belts should be securely attached to all factory-installed lifting brackets or designated lifting points.
- All designated lifting points should be used together. Do not attach the lifting equipment to only part of the available brackets, as uneven loading may cause the fitting to become unstable or damaged during lifting.
- Before lifting, check that every lifting belt is correctly positioned and securely fastened to the designated brackets. The lifting arrangement should be inspected by the responsible site personnel before the load is raised.
- Fittings should be lifted smoothly and evenly to prevent sudden movement, swinging, or impact against other products, vehicles, or structures.
- Personnel should remain clear of the suspended load during lifting and unloading operations. No person should stand underneath a suspended pipe or fitting.
